Matrix impact is a wide term describing the tendency of certain analyte matrices to change the detection or quantification of an analyte. This result ordinarily manifests alone being a bias and brings about below or overestimating the answer's current analyte focus.

Reversed stage HPLC (RP-HPLC) provides more info a non-polar stationary section and an aqueous, reasonably polar cellular stage. One particular popular stationary period check here is a silica that has been surface area-modified with RMe2SiCl, exactly where R is actually a straight chain alkyl group like C18H37 or C8H17. With this sort of stationary phases, retention time is more time for molecules which happen to be a lot less polar, whilst polar molecules elute far more commonly (early inside the analysis). An analyst can enhance retention times by adding far more h2o to your cell phase; thereby earning the affinity of your hydrophobic analyte for that hydrophobic stationary period more robust relative towards the now extra hydrophilic cellular period.
